Olubayo A. Idowu, M.D., P.A. Find A Doctor Directions Olubayo A. Idowu, M.D., P.A. 2727 Bolton Boone Dr Ste 102 Desoto, TX 75115-2019 United States (972) 283-8777 Directions 32.6451311, -96.8790505